Beer deliveries up in January, though exports plunge

Beer deliveries from factories in January 2025 reached 1.82 million litres, marking a 6.3% increase compared to January 2024, according to Cystat.

The growth was driven entirely by the domestic market, which recorded a 13.6% rise in beer deliveries.

However, exports fell to zero, leading to a 100% decline in international beer shipments. This follows an 82% rise in December 2024 but a significant fluctuation in the months prior.
